Students, whether from the European Union (EU) or outside the EU, enrolling for the first time at a French institution of higher education (FIRST-TIME STUDENTS)who have submitted an application through the Études en France Portal (Campus France) and have received their admission notification...
In view of your situation...
You must make an appointment by calling +33 4 76 04 10 00 between August 20, 2026, and September 1, 2026, from 8:30 a.m. to 1:00 p.m. and from 2: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m., for in-person administrative registration , which will take place betweenSeptember 1 and September 14,2026
You must download the 2026–2027 administrative registration packet and the list of required supporting documents (at the bottom of this page)
On the day of your appointment, you must come to the address below (Room A021) with your registration form fully completed and signed, along with the required supporting documents and proof of payment (credit card).
ATTENTION: Registration for some courses is done in person on the first day of the school year.

►►►PLEASE NOTE
To register for the AEI (Accueil Echanges Internationaux) program :
A letter of acceptance from UGA - UFR PhITEM is required.
You are not required to pay the Student and Campus Life Fee (CVEC)
To enroll in the Magistère de Physique :
Eligible students must first enroll in a national degree program (bachelor , 1st-year master’s, or 2nd-year master’s).
Additional registration for the Magistère program will take place in late September at the UFR Registrar’s Office reception desk (contact information below). The date will be communicated to interested students in due course.
